I used the Defender case on a few of my phones...tuff as nails is a good saying for them and offer a over abundance of protection if you really need that much for day to day usage...I never had a issue with them stretching out and needing a replacement...but I wasn't constantly pulling them off to do battery pulls either.I did wear out some of the rubber ports and had a replacement on that cause though..
On the defender..the screen protector didn't fair well enough for me though..and had the tendency to be a dust magnet underneath it on mine and using the S-pen..I don't know how well they will do...just something to keep in mind.
Last thoughts ...is the all the extra bulk added to a already large mobile device as our Note II's are...which is the main reason I choose to go back to the best case I ever used IMHO...which is the Seidio Surface case with belt clip.I ordered mine directly from the company..but..Best Buy will be selling the non-kickstand version under their Pt branding..and most should have them in stock for the holidays...
If you have never used one of these cases before...I would give some time for places to get them in-stock so you can go put one on and see for yourself if it will work for you or not...you may not like the size or how they fit on your Note...

Like I said...I feel the Seidio Surface case is the best one out there..In my job...I've dropped mine already (4 feet)..have banged it hard on ladders and other equipment..and it is still perfect..
My Pt case (Best Buy branded Seidio Surface case) I used on my Captivate has taken even rougher treatment over the 2 years I've had it and has not failed..so I'm pretty sold on the Seidio Surface line for all types of bumps & bruises a phone gets on my hip...They aren't water proof...and if you need something for water issues these won't work...but for everything except that and a full onslaught against the screen...they have performed above my expectations of a case and give good gripping while being fairly thin feeling..
Buy a good screen protector like the anti glare/smudge that AT&T stores sell (iFrogz)...and you will have a damn good protection package that looks great too..The Pt case when in stock at Best Buy is about $20 cheaper.
